What is Dribbble?

Dribbble is a social media platform for designers and other creatives to share their work, collaborate with others, and get inspiration from fellow designers. It was founded in 2009 by Dan Cederholm and Rich Thornett, and it has since grown into a community of millions of designers and creatives worldwide.

How Does Dribbble Work?

Dribbble works like most social media platforms, with a few differences. Users create an account and upload their work in the form of "shots." A shot is a single image or animation that showcases a piece of work, such as a logo design, a website layout, or an illustration.

One of the unique aspects of Dribbble is the invitation system. To become a member, you must receive an invitation from an existing member, or you can apply to be a prospect, where you submit your work to be reviewed by the Dribbble team for consideration. This exclusivity has helped to create a tight-knit community of designers and creatives who value quality work.

Once you're a member, you can follow other designers, comment on their work, and join groups that match your interests or style. You can also participate in design challenges, where Dribbble members are given a specific design prompt to work on and share their designs.

Why Use Dribbble?

Dribbble offers several benefits to designers and other creatives, including:

Showcase your work: Dribbble allows you to showcase your work to a global audience of designers and creatives, which can help you gain recognition and exposure for your designs.

Connect with other designers: Dribbble is an excellent platform for building connections with other designers in your field, which can lead to collaborations, job opportunities, and mentorship.

Get inspiration: Dribbble is a great source of design inspiration, with millions of designs and ideas to explore. You can browse shots by category, tags, or search for specific keywords.

Participate in design challenges: Dribbble's design challenges are a great way to practice your design skills, challenge yourself, and get feedback from other designers.

Build your personal brand: Dribbble is a great platform for building a personal brand and showcasing your unique style and creative vision.

How to Make the Most of Dribbble

If you're new to Dribbble or want to make the most of the platform, here are a few tips:

Be selective with your shots: Dribbble is a curated platform, and only the best work gets featured. Make sure to select your best work to showcase and keep your profile updated regularly.

Engage with other designers: Engage with other designers by commenting on their work, joining groups, and participating in design challenges. This will help you build connections and get feedback on your work.

Use tags and descriptions: Make sure to use relevant tags and descriptions for your shots, so they can be easily found by other designers searching for inspiration.

Promote your work: Share your Dribbble shots on other social media platforms, your portfolio website, or your blog to increase your exposure and reach a wider audience.

Stay active: Regularly post new work, engage with other designers, and participate in design challenges to stay active on the platform
